<p>Facilities Service Coordinator</p> <p>Under general supervision, the Facilities Services Coordinator is responsible for facilities operations including coordination of services and activities that provide a physical environment that promotes institutional excellence and ensures the health and safety of occupants. This position provides leadership and supervision to staff, maximizing efficiencies and following directed policies, procedures and protocols.</p> <p>Job Expectations:</p> <ul> <li>Knowledge of facilities and industry standards in cleaning and maintenance of buildings. </li><li>Knowledge of safety standards and safe work practices. </li><li>Knowledge of institutional policies and procedures. </li><li>Knowledge of administrative activities to include preparation of specific and period reports, fiscal records and service changes. </li><li>Knowledge of measures to improve production/service methods, equipment performance, scheduling and quality control. </li><li>Knowledge of aseptic cleaning and maintenance techniques. </li><li>Knowledge of computer operations and windows software programs. </li><li>Ability to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ing, with students, faculty, staff, vendors and the general public. </li><li>Ability to lead, coach, motivate, direct, train and provide resources to staff members of the unit. </li></ul> <p>For a detailed job description, please email Rebecca Hoag at rebecca-hoag@uiowa.edu.</p> <p>About the Division of Student Life:</p> <p>The Division of Student Life is comprised of staff that embrace new ideas and thoughts, works together to keep our students safe, and provides them with life-changing experiences. The Division of Student Life includes 15 departments that span from Recreation Services to the Office of Leadership, Service and Civic Engagement and everything in between. We believe in working together as one team to achieve our mission: fostering student success by creating and promoting educationally purposeful services and activities within and beyond the classroom.</p> <p>Minimum Eligibility Requirements:</p> <ul> <li>Graduation from high school or GED equivalent, and </li><li>Three years supervisory and facilities management experience, and </li><li>Valid driver's license and ability to meet UI Fleet Safety Standards. </li></ul> <p>Desirable Qualifications:</p> <ul> <li>Commercial custodial experience </li><li>Ability to maintain a high level of confidentiality. </li><li>ISSA Certified Trainer Certification or ability to complete and pass the course within 12 months of employment (travel may be required). </li></ul> <p>Application Details:</p> <p>Job openings are posted for a minimum of 10 calendar days and may be removed from posting and filled any time after the original posting period has ended.</p> <p>Successful candidates will be required to self-disclose any conviction history and will be subject to a criminal background check and credential/education verification.
